It seems Rimmel Wake me Up foundation has been discontinued and replaced with Lasting Radiance, which is totally inferior! I've tried L'Oréal True Match and I'm not really impressed tbh. I do wear Estée Lauder Doublewear, but this is too expensive for every day use. Please give me some recommendations!!

I'm 40, my skin is pretty good, but can become oily as I live in a hot climate. I also have the some fine lines. I'm looking for decent coverage, non cakey and long wearing.

It's not comparable to ELDW at all,it's a nice sheer to medium coverage but if you're used to DW I think you'll be disappointed. I buy big testers of 20mls of DW on eBay for about £11. Works out much cheaper. I only buy from the big sellers.

No 7 hydroluminous as I said earlier is nice. Revlon Colourstay is the only thing I've ever tried which is comparable to DW, not quite as good but good!

OP, I've been using L'Oreal true match because it is the only one that has a shade that is EXACTLY like my skin. However, it doesn't last the whole day. By 3pm I'm a greasy mess. I went shopping yesterday and looked at the foundations in the Body Shop (never bought make up from there before) and I ended up buying the Matte Clay clarifying foundation. I have been wearing it since 10am today. I've gone into town twice, cooked dinner, washed dishes etc. and the foundation is still looking really good. I'll take a picture and post it.

Go and try the Flower Beauty Light Illusion Foundation. It’s cheap, has a great skin-like finish, has awesome coverage, etc. The lasting power is fab. My skin is extremely combination because I am going through perimenopause (47yrs) and have open pores pouring grease everywhere where there weren’t any before and I’m dry as a desert around my eyes and around the edges. I have never had so many compliments since I started using this foundation. (Oh, and it plays nicely with both primers (smashbox primerizer/twofaced hangover primer and moisturizers I use as well.) - btw I bought the Fenty primer and gave it to my daughter as I prefer the Flower one.
